Output e2d91434c35de13c5becd1933fda4873423cdc575fd8ec8ea065424724c68cfa:0

value
34413600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97029dfc515bb1f00d15d1eb7c8f7956cee2c11f OP_EQUAL
address
3FTV6MM6hb6ziXsHn3yNiVqA46Ny1jTDrA
transaction
e2d91434c35de13c5becd1933fda4873423cdc575fd8ec8ea065424724c68cfa
spent
true